Peace N the Hood Job Fair a big success!

Our very own “Log Cabin” at Steve Cox Memorial Park was home to the the first Peace N the Hood Job Fair and 4th annual 3:3 basketball tournament this past Wednesday, June 28.

Now in its fourth year, the 3:3 basketball tournament involved some 200 kids ages 12-19, but the job fair was really the highlight, focusing on employment opportunities for people aged 16-24 years old. The event featured more than 25 employers and 15 resource providers, including Starbucks Coffee Company, Taco Time NW, Downtown Seattle Association, King County, White Center Community Development Association, and FareStart, among many more.

More than 150 young adults turned out for the job fair. In many cases, participants could fill out job applications on the spot, and there were help sessions for those who wanted to build their resumés and practice the job application process.

Many thanks to Southwest Youth and Family Services, the organizer of the job fair and tournament.
